The American Valve M76QT 3/4" Quarter Turn Hose Bibb features a female IPS threaded inlet and a full port ball valve design that delivers unrestricted water flow. Crafted from durable brass with a heavy-duty metal handle, it offers easy quarter-turn operation and reliable performance for all your outdoor water needs.

I have 1/2 and 3/4 of these. Both M and F thread. And IMO, they are the gold standard. I used to pass over them since there were cheaper "1/4 turn" valves out there. But even some that claim "full port" don't have ports as big as these. These are truly full port, the ball is polished stainless and works even after months and years of staying in the same position. The threads are perfectly cut. the handle is better quality than the cheap ones. The shape is better. Professional plumbers carry this quality of valve. I can't find a single thing to complain about, so 5 stars. The last valve you have to mess with.

These 1/4 turn hose bib valves are great. They are full flow, so they are not restrictive of your water pressure. Since they open with a quarter turn of the handle they are prefect for older folks with hand issues, or anyone really. It's got soild brass construction, not plated, and work for years, and years before accumulating too much mineral deposits. I just take them off, and soak them in CLR for an hour, then reinstall them. Get these, you'll appreciate how easy it is to turn on, and off your hose can be !!
